1. Implement Smart Infrastructure Monitoring

Real-time monitoring systems help industries track operational performance, identify risks early, and maintain efficient pipeline and infrastructure operations.

2. Improve Operational Efficiency Through Automation

Advanced automation technologies and intelligent operational systems improve refinery accuracy, reduce downtime, and optimize industrial energy performance.

3. Maintain Industry-Certified Safety Standards

Following strict safety protocols and compliance systems helps businesses maintain secure operational environments and reduce infrastructure risks.

4. Optimize Pipeline Transportation Systems

Modern pipeline technologies improve transportation reliability, maintain uninterrupted energy flow, and support large-scale industrial operations worldwide.

5. Invest in Scalable Energy Infrastructure

Scalable infrastructure systems help industries support growing operational demands while maintaining long-term performance and reliability.

6. Use Predictive Maintenance Technologies

Predictive monitoring systems allow industries to detect potential operational issues before failures occur, reducing downtime and maintenance costs.

7. Support Sustainable Industrial Energy Operations

Integrating energy-efficient systems and smart infrastructure technologies helps industries maintain environmentally responsible operational performance.
